Planning to develop a CPU on an FPGA. How can I program it?
I did a similar project to implement a soft-microcontroller based on an ARM Cortex-M0. My strategy was to compile the code, convert the binary into ASCII and use it to initialize the value of a general purpose RAM block during HDL synthesis. In case you want to take a look: https://github.com/vfinotti/cortex-m0-soft-microcontroller. The downside is that changing the program implies in running the synthesis again.
